Coming off four-game series against division opponents, the Pittsburgh Pirates and Minnesota Twins will face off Friday night to open a weekend set.
Advertisement
The game marks the season debut for Pirates starter Jared Jones, who will make his first start since Sept. 27, 2024 after completing his rehab from elbow surgery. Still just 24 years old, the right-hander had a promising rookie season two years ago before sitting out all of 2025.
He rejoins a Pirates team that has been playing solid baseball but can’t catch a break in the standings, as the NL Central remains the lone division in baseball with every team boasting a winning record.
The same cannot be said about the AL Central, where the Twins sit in the middle of the pack alongside the resurgent White Sox with everyone looking up at the Guardians. Minnesota has shaken off its April malaise with a strong May and will send arguably its most effective starter to the mound Friday in Taj Bradley, who is 5-1 with a 2.77 ERA and has allowed just 42Â hits in 52 innings while striking out 59.

What channel is Pirates vs. Twins on today?
Pirates vs. Twins will not air on traditional television Friday. The game will stream live as part of Apple TV’s “Friday Night Baseball” package.
New subscribers get their first week of Apple TV for free. After that, they can subscribe for just $12.99/month.
Subscribers can watch “Friday Night Baseball” with the Apple TV app, which is available on select smart TVs, Roku devices, Amazon Fire TV, and gaming consoles.
Pirates vs. Twins start time
First pitch of Pirates vs. Twins on Friday is set for 6:45 p.m. ET. The game will be played at PNC Park in Pittsburgh.
